Full description
If you do not understand anything on this page please contact us.
Marden, general area: surface-finds of several Palaeolithic handaxes from the Beult gravels in Maidstone Museum, presented by Mrs Kennard (perhaps after AS Kennard's death in 1948) (1-2). Recorded by Roe in the 1960s (3), then listed in the Southern Rivers Project in the 1990s (4).
